Morelia, Michoacan.– All the spas public and private will be supervisedwith the sole objective of ensuring that the waters of the pools do not represent a danger for bathers who go out to enjoy the Summer Vacation in Michoacan.
Operations to prevent health risks in swimming pools will be in charge of the Secretary of Health of Michoacán (SSM), through its Jurisdictional Coordination for the Protection against Sanitary Risks (COJUPRIS), who They are already carrying out operations to verify that the state’s swimming pools and spas are suitable for human recreation.
Prior to the summer vacations, the staff of the COJUPRIS of the eight health jurisdictions, they will sample more than 105 pools and spas, including those of hotels, sports clubs and swimming schools, so that in case of detecting any anomaly in the water of the swimming pools, these can be corrected before the holiday period in July.
With these preventive actions, health risks are avoided in the user population, since for this the health authority has a program of “Bacteriological Quality in Swimming Pool Water”which is intended protect the population user of diseases associated with water contamination, such as conjunctivitis, dermatitis and gastrointestinal diseases.
During the sampling, the COJUPRIS staff of Uruapan, already suspended a pool, after the results taken in the water were out of the norm. This pool must empty the water, wash and carve the walls, to later disinfect it and fill it again; Only then will it be allowed to open it, to avoid health risks.
will be 105 the spas, swimming pools and sports clubs which will be verified; and in these places water samples will be taken, to detect or rule out the presence of fecal coliforms, E. Colli and free-living amoebae.

Surveillance of swimming pools by health authorities is permanent, there are inspection operations throughout the year, but intensifies during vacation periods.
